How does the Ezafe chain work in ناو غول‌پیکر اتمی, and why is the order of adjectives strictly in this sequence?
The phrase connects the noun ناو (warship) to its two adjectives using the Ezafe (the unseen -e sound). In Farsi, when chaining adjectives, general descriptive adjectives like غول‌پیکر (gigantic) usually come before classifying or technical adjectives like اتمی (nuclear). If you reversed them to ناو اتمی غول‌پیکر, it would sound highly unnatural, similar to saying 'a nuclear gigantic warship' in English.
What is the literal breakdown of the adjective غول‌پیکر?
It literally translates to 'ghoul-bodied' or 'demon-figured.' It is a compound formed from غول (ghoul, giant, or monster) and پیکر (body or form). In modern Farsi, it is a very common and evocative way to say 'gigantic' or 'colossal.'
Is the phrase به محض اینکه (as soon as) always followed by the simple past tense, as seen with غرق شد?
Not always. Because this sentence describes a completed past event, it uses the simple past tense غرق شد (sank). However, if you were talking about a future event (e.g., 'As soon as the ship sinks...'), you would need to use the present subjunctive mood: به محض اینکه غرق شود.
The word خدمه (crew) acts like a collective noun. Does it always take a plural verb like فرار کردند?
Yes. خدمه is an Arabic broken plural (from خادم, meaning servant or attendant). In Farsi, when referring to the crew of a ship, aircraft, or train, it inherently represents multiple people and strongly prefers a plural verb like فرار کردند (they escaped).
